Decentralized Exchanges vs. Traditional Brokers: The Bitcoin Trading Landscape arena

The world of Bitcoin trading has witnessed a seismic transformation with the manifestation of decentralized exchanges (DEXs). These platforms present a stark contrast to traditional brokers, disrupting the established norm. DEXs operate on blockchain technology, eliminating the need for intermediaries and providing traders with immediate control over their assets. In contrast, traditional brokers act as intermediaries, connecting buyers and sellers while holding customer funds.

  • DEXs foster openness by recording all transactions on the public blockchain, making it challenging for any single entity to manipulate prices or commit fraud. Traditional brokers, although often governed by rules, may lack in this regard due to the concentrated nature of their operations.
  • Furthermore, DEXs typically involve lower fees compared to traditional brokers, as they minimize the need for costly infrastructure and staffing. As a result, traders can retain a larger share of their profits.

The choice between DEXs and traditional brokers ultimately relies on individual preferences. While DEXs present benefits such as pseudonymity, transparency, and lower fees, they may involve a steeper learning curve for novice traders. Traditional brokers, on the other hand, offer a more conventional trading experience with dedicated customer support and direction.
